Geographic information science (gis): social & cultural geographic applications. Problems too complex to be solved by a single thing, needs a combination of things. Gis is a platform for managing, analyzing and applying geographic information. A framework and process transforming how we think and act, creating a more sustainable future. Today it is a multibillion dollar business used in many sectors of our economy. Current estimated value of the geospatial industry is billion usd and growing at ~30% per year. There is not a mainstream industry not using gis and its related technologies. Currently, twitter has 330 million monthly active users. Currently 500 million tweets sent around the world daily (82% use their phone to tweet) Can be a source of geographic data during crises and emergencies (e. g. haiti earthquake, philippines flooding) Can be a cost-effective source of geographic data. Can be used as a source of geographic data because it is timely.
